Length Expected UpRuns (O-E)^2/E DownRuns (O-E)^2/E 2 66666.67 66852 0.52 66534 0.26 3 25000.00 24941 0.14 25161 1.04 4 6666.67 6520 3.23 6677 0.02 5 1388.89 1414 0.45 1365 0.41 6 238.10 234 0.07 223 0.96 7 34.72 34 0.01 37 0.15 8 4.96 4 0.19 2 1.77 p=0.40481 p=0.40409 Number of rngs required: 687491, p-value: 0.145 RESULTS OF CRAPS TEST for dh-ranFile-2015-07-03_13:31 No. of wins: Observed Expected 98799 98585.9 z-score= 0.953, pvalue=0.82978 Analysis of Throws-per-Game: Throws Observed Expected Chisq Sum of (O-E)^2/E 1 66485 66666.7 0.495 0.495 2 37738 37654.3 0.186 0.681 3 27103 26954.7 0.816 1.497 4 19269 19313.5 0.102 1.599 5 13899 13851.4 0.163 1.762 6 9920 9943.5 0.056 1.818 7 7153 7145.0 0.009 1.827 8 5106 5139.1 0.213 2.040 9 3709 3699.9 0.023 2.062 10 2706 2666.3 0.591 2.654 11 1867 1923.3 1.650 4.303 12 1350 1388.7 1.081 5.384 13 1076 1003.7 5.206 10.590 14 724 726.1 0.006 10.596 15 482 525.8 3.654 14.250 16 394 381.2 0.433 14.684 17 269 276.5 0.206 14.889 18 210 200.8 0.419 15.308 19 166 146.0 2.744 18.052 20 118 106.2 1.308 19.360 21 256 287.1 3.372 22.731 Chisq= 22.73 for 20 degrees of freedom, p= 0.69783 SUMMARY of craptest p-value for no. of wins: 0.829779 p-value for throws/game: 0.697829 _____________________________________________________________ RESULTS OF CRAPS TEST2 for dh-ranFile-2015-07-03_13:31 No. of wins: Observed Expected 98555 98585.9 z-score=-0.138, pvalue=0.44511 Analysis of Throws-per-Game: Throws Observed Expected Chisq Sum of (O-E)^2/E 1 66471 66666.7 0.574 0.574 2 37626 37654.3 0.021 0.596 3 26865 26954.7 0.299 0.894 4 19461 19313.5 1.127 2.021 5 13988 13851.4 1.347 3.368 6 10000 9943.5 0.321 3.689 7 7126 7145.0 0.051 3.739 8 5105 5139.1 0.226 3.965 9 3606 3699.9 2.381 6.347 10 2684 2666.3 0.118 6.464 11 1986 1923.3 2.042 8.506 12 1412 1388.7 0.390 8.896 13 1061 1003.7 3.269 12.165 14 694 726.1 1.423 13.588 15 547 525.8 0.852 14.440 16 377 381.2 0.045 14.485 17 246 276.5 3.373 17.857 18 217 200.8 1.302 19.159 19 143 146.0 0.061 19.220 20 86 106.2 3.847 23.068 21 299 287.1 0.492 23.560 Chisq= 23.56 for 20 degrees of freedom, p= 0.73785 SUMMARY of craptest p-value for no. of wins: 0.445113 p-value for throws/game: 0.737853 _____________________________________________________________ ***** TEST SUMMARY ***** All p-values: 0.0024,0.0066,0.0129,0.0170,0.0185,0.0209,0.0212,0.0239,0.0248,0.0257, 0.0277,0.0298,0.0310,0.0339,0.0380,0.0424,0.0453,0.0480,0.0506,0.0543, 0.0570,0.0602,0.0606,0.0609,0.0632,0.0867,0.0927,0.0981,0.0989,0.1067, 0.1086,0.1125,0.1202,0.1246,0.1294,0.1302,0.1451,0.1464,0.1466,0.1468, 0.1494,0.1503,0.1562,0.1576,0.1643,0.1696,0.1784,0.1840,0.1846,0.1870, 0.1991,0.2007,0.2120,0.2151,0.2166,0.2201,0.2205,0.2226,0.2229,0.2289, 0.2292,0.2293,0.2321,0.2337,0.2357,0.2361,0.2364,0.2374,0.2537,0.2572, 0.2597,0.2646,0.2661,0.2674,0.2683,0.2692,0.2735,0.2764,0.2783,0.2808, 0.2822,0.2842,0.2855,0.2862,0.2866,0.2870,0.2931,0.2952,0.3174,0.3208, 0.3245,0.3255,0.3412,0.3566,0.3621,0.3633,0.3643,0.3647,0.3706,0.3708, 0.3756,0.3825,0.3875,0.4041,0.4045,0.4048,0.4091,0.4097,0.4109,0.4126, 0.4150,0.4173,0.4177,0.4197,0.4217,0.4219,0.4311,0.4319,0.4338,0.4406, 0.4451,0.4456,0.4459,0.4490,0.4523,0.4560,0.4688,0.4703,0.4706,0.4728, 0.4811,0.4890,0.4957,0.4977,0.5043,0.5060,0.5064,0.5077,0.5083,0.5144, 0.5156,0.5184,0.5231,0.5252,0.5364,0.5389,0.5399,0.5453,0.5470,0.5477, 0.5521,0.5544,0.5595,0.5605,0.5611,0.5637,0.5647,0.5684,0.5725,0.5785, 0.5854,0.5860,0.5870,0.5928,0.5944,0.6040,0.6067,0.6088,0.6160,0.6183, 0.6221,0.6239,0.6267,0.6268,0.6302,0.6319,0.6502,0.6517,0.6550,0.6717, 0.6748,0.6760,0.6787,0.6881,0.6890,0.6932,0.6978,0.7057,0.7058,0.7081, 0.7123,0.7160,0.7208,0.7318,0.7367,0.7379,0.7387,0.7429,0.7457,0.7500, 0.7512,0.7608,0.7718,0.7735,0.7779,0.7809,0.7908,0.7987,0.8026,0.8086, 0.8175,0.8205,0.8295,0.8298,0.8308,0.8341,0.8353,0.8368,0.8386,0.8403, 0.8418,0.8520,0.8546,0.8554,0.8590,0.8605,0.8615,0.8649,0.8749,0.8778, 0.8849,0.8878,0.8900,0.8905,0.8912,0.8981,0.8982,0.9009,0.9022,0.9027, 0.9045,0.9056,0.9057,0.9086,0.9173,0.9175,0.9218,0.9278,0.9305,0.9336, 0.9336,0.9360,0.9397,0.9403,0.9403,0.9440,0.9458,0.9488,0.9505,0.9525, 0.9676,0.9684,0.9727,0.9731,0.9766,0.9877,0.9885,0.9894,0.9903, Overall p-value after applying KStest on 269 p-values = 0.824564 In response to requests, we have provided a list of all the p-values produced by the tests you have chosen for this run. The individual p-values are supposed to be uniform in [0,1), but they are not necessarily independent. So even though we have applied a KSTEST to the accumulated p-values, the result is not necessarily---even if your file contains truly random bits---uniform in [0,1). But it is probably pretty close, so take that last p-value with a grain of salt. In particular, there may be some values so close to 0 or 1 that the tests they came from should be applied several more times, or new, related tests should be undertaken.
